Module: TFW::Setters
- Included in:
- Module
- Defined in:
- lib/tfw/setters.rb
Overview
Module to create dynamic setters
Instance Method Summary collapse
Instance Method Details
#make_setter(*names) ⇒ Object
6 7 8 9 10 11 12 13 |
# File 'lib/tfw/setters.rb', line 6 def make_setter(*names) names.each do |name| define_method(name) do |val| instance_variable_set("@#{name}", val) return self end end end |